Changed order, too late?
Feel foolish, but I asked to change the color and interior on my m235i on may 10 or 11th, when production is scheduled for week of June 8. CA was hesitant whether changes could be made.
Thoughts? I know there are threads on this but I'm not sure if BMW Canada has different policies than other countries... |

You should have no problems changing the options as long as your vehicle is not in production. I was able to make changes a few days before mine entered production.
